|
In diesem Seminar lernt der Teilnehmer die Shells kennen, das wichtigste und eines der mächtigsten Werkzeuge von Unix. Der Teilnehmer wird nach Besuch des Kurses in der Lage sein, auch komplexe Aufgaben mit eigenen Shellskripten effektiv zu lösen.
Zielgruppe
Administratoren und Softwareentwickler, die mit Unix oder Linux arbeiten und diese Systeme professionell und rationell einsetzen wollen.
Hinweis Für alle, die nicht intensiv mit Unix arbeiten wollen/werden, aber eigene einfache Shellscripte aufbauen wollen, empfehlen wir den Kurs Unix Vertiefung.Diese Unix/Linux-Schulung kann als Firmenkurs auch in englischer Sprache durchgeführt werden. |
Einleitung
Überblick über die Shells
- Eigenschaften der Bourne-Shell
- Eigenschaften der C-Shell
- Eigenschaften der Korn-Shell
- OpenSource Shell bash
- OpenSource Shell tcsh
Die Bourne Shell (Bourne Again Shell)
- Kommandozeile
- Sequenzen
- Bedingungen
- Ein- und Ausgabekanäle
- Pipe
- Kommandosubstitution
- Maskieren
- History
- Makros
- Editier-Modi (vi-mode, emacs-mode)
- Alias Mechanismus
- Shell-Optionen
Das Kommando test
- test und Zeichenketten
- test und numerische Ausdrücke
Zahlen verarbeiten mit expr
Die Startdateien der Shells (profiles)
Shell als Programmiersprache
- Shellvariable
- Basis-Shell-Programmierung
- Ablaufsteuerung
- Schleifen
- Integer-Arithmetik
- Funktionen
- Rückgabewerte
- Variablenattribute
- Felder
- Erweiterte Ein- und Ausgabetechniken
- Prozesssteuerung
- Metazeichen
Vertiefung
- Skriptaufbau
- Konfliktfreie Namensvergabe
- Ablaufoptimiertes Programmieren
- Debuggern von Scripten
- Abfangen von Signalen im Script
Weitere Dienstprogramme
- Anzeigen, Vergleichen, Suchen und Sortieren von Dateien
|
Kurs-ID: LinuxSh
Dauer
5 Tage /
i.d.R.: 8:00 - 15:30 Uhr
Offener Kurs
Der Seminarpreis einschließlich Seminarunterlagen beträgt pro Teilnehmer 1.475,00 € zzgl. MwSt. (1.755,25 € inkl. MwSt.)
Termin laut Terminplan oder auf Anfrage
zur Anmeldung
Durchführung: ab 3 Pers.
Firmenkurs
Termine nach Vereinbarung.
Preise für Individual- und Firmenschulungen auf Anfrage.
Vorkenntnisse
Kenntnisse im Umfang des Kurses Unix Grundlagen sind notwendig.
Weiterführende Kurse
|